Deceiver vs Deception - What's the difference?

deceiver | deception |

As nouns the difference between deceiver and deception

is that deceiver is a person who lies or deceives while deception is an instance of actions and/or schemes fabricated to mislead and/or delude someone into errantly believing a lie or inaccuracy.
